Course Details

Introduction to Sustainable Building: Fundamentals of green building, sustainable design and construction principles, energy efficiency, and environmental impact assessment.
Nanotechnology in Construction: Overview of nanotechnology, nanomaterials, and their applications in the construction industry, including smart materials, self-healing concrete, and advanced coatings.
Sustainable Materials and Resources: Evaluation of eco-friendly materials, life-cycle assessment, renewable resources, and waste management in building design and construction.
Energy-efficient Building Systems: High-performance HVAC, lighting, insulation, and water systems, including renewable energy technologies and their integration into building design.
Indoor Air Quality and Health: Assessment of indoor air quality, ventilation strategies, thermal comfort, and their impact on occupant health and productivity.
Building Information Modeling (BIM) and Sustainability: Integration of BIM in sustainable building design, construction, and operation, including energy analysis and life-cycle costing.
Advanced Nanotechnology for Sustainable Building: Cutting-edge nanotechnology applications in sustainable building, including advanced insulation, phase change materials, and sensors for energy management.
Policy and Incentives for Sustainable Building: Overview of government policies, regulations, and incentives promoting sustainable building, including LEED certification and energy codes.
Case Studies in Sustainable Building: Analysis of successful sustainable building projects, including design strategies, performance data, and lessons learned.

Career Path

In the UK, the demand for professionals in sustainable building and advanced nanotechnology is growing. Let's take a closer look at the job market trends and the distribution of roles in this emerging field, represented by a 3D pie chart. 1. **Architectural Designer:** With a focus on sustainable design, architectural designers create efficient and eco-friendly buildings. Their role is essential in reducing the environmental impact of construction and promoting energy-efficient structures. 2. **Sustainability Consultant:** Sustainability consultants provide expert guidance in reducing the ecological footprint of buildings. They collaborate with architects, engineers, and construction teams to ensure environmentally friendly practices and materials are integrated throughout a project's lifecycle. 3. **Nanotechnology Engineer:** Nanotechnology engineers specialize in applying nanoscale materials and processes to improve building performance, durability, and energy efficiency. Their expertise helps create innovative solutions for sustainable construction. 4. **Green Building Materials Specialist:** These professionals ensure that eco-friendly materials are incorporated into building designs. They research, source, and recommend sustainable materials that align with a project's goals and budget. 5. **Policy Analyst (Green Buildings):** Policy analysts specializing in green buildings study and interpret regulations, guidelines, and standards that impact sustainable construction. They help organizations and governments understand and implement policies promoting sustainable building practices.
